CHERRY HILL, N.J. - The second set of 2003 World Championships Trials for non-Olympic-class boats began Wednesday on Cooper River with heats in three events - the lightweight men's single sculls, lightweight women's single sculls, and lightweight women's pair. Winners of the trials earn the right to represent the United States at the 2003 FISA World Championships August 24-31 in Milan, Italy.
In the lightweight men's single sculls, Andrew Liverman recorded the fastest time of the morning heats. Racing in the first of three heats, Liverman clocked a 7:20.32 to defeat Undine Barge Club's Jon D'Alba by nearly 13 seconds. Potomac Boat Club's Jeff Anchukaitis finished third. In the second heat, Eric Wilhelm finished in a 7:27.85, more than 27 seconds ahead of Riverside Boat Club's Sean Wolf. CSUS Aquatic Center's Sam Sweitzer finished third. In the third heat, Union Boat Club's Aleks Zosuls stroked a 7:22.45 to finish 2.37 seconds ahead of Ann Arbor Rowing Club's Brian Tryon. Augusta Rowing Club's Sixto Portilla finished third, followed by Deep Eddy Rowing Club's Liam O'Brien. The top two finishers in each of the three heats advanced directly to tomorrow's semifinals. The remaining boats headed to Wednesday afternoon's repechage, or second-chance race, where Anchukaitis and Portilla advanced to the semifinals.
In the lightweight women's single sculls, Riverside Boat Club's Sarah Howlett recorded the fastest time of the heats, clocking a 7:59.90 to finish 5.10 seconds ahead of Union Boat Club's Catharine Infantino. Dayton's Trish Miles finished third, followed by Dallas Rowing Club's Amy Molenaar. In the other heat, Pocock Rowing Center's Julia Nichols stroked an 8:00.34 to finish 11.48 seconds ahead of Riverside's Heather Moon. Occoquan Boat Club's Melissa Rice finished third, followed by Erin Burton. The winner of each heat advanced to Friday's first final, while the remaining scullers will race in the repechages Thursday morning.
Undine Barge Club's Meghan Sarbanis and Renee Hykel won the second heat of the lightweight women's pair, recording the fastest time of the morning. Sarbanis and Hykel clocked a 7:31.41 to finish more than 16 seconds ahead of the Potomac Boat Club Composite crew of Melanie Borger and Alessandra Phillips. In the first heat, Riverside Boat Club's Ashley Lanfer and Tina Vandersteel won with a time of 7:39.07. The crew finished 5.26 seconds ahead of the Cambridge/Riverside pair of Amy Scott and Abigail Cromwell. Nereid Boat Club's Katherine Orendorf and Amanda Spires finished third. Following the heat, Orendorf and Spires scratched themselves from the repechage, so the remaining four crews advanced directly to the first final.
In addition to the three events that started today, seven additional trials events will be contested this week. The men's pair with coxswain, lightweight men's pair, lightweight men's quadruple sculls, lightweight women's quadruple sculls, women's four, men's four with coxswain, and lightweight men's eight are all finals-only events that begin Friday with the first final in the best two-out-of-three finals format. Second finals will be held Saturday, with third finals being held Sunday, if necessary. Trials' racing begins at 8 a.m. each day.
